Text

No officer, member or employee of the board may be financially interested, directly or indirectly, in any contract of any person with the board, or in the sale of any property, real or personal, to or by the board. This section does not apply to contracts or purchases of property, real or personal, between the board and any governmental agency. No officer, member or employee of the board may have or acquire any financial interest, either direct or indirect, in any project or activity of the board or in any services or material to be used or furnished in connection with any project or activity of the board.
